Abstract:

The paper presents a band-pass filter (BPF) intended for substrate integrated waveguide (SIW) applications, supplied with a novel broadband transition from SIW to miniature coaxial connectors through an intermediate coplanar(CPW) transmission line. The band-pass filter uses inductive diaphragms defined by rows of metal plated via holes of equal diameters. Simulated characteristics are in excellent agreement with experimental results, although BPF simulations were performed with standard waveguide ports while the manufactured component is provided with the novel CPW transition on both ports.
